“All players are overpaid”: how to explain the crazy spending of English clubs in the transfer window?

It is a transfer window where madness has been linked for English clubs. As usual, the residents of the Premier League did not hesitate to put their hands in their pockets to attract the best players. OL jumped on an offer from West Ham of 60 million euros to let Lucas Paqueta slip away. Wesley Fofana became the 4th most expensive defender in history on Wednesday after joining Chelsea for 82 million euros. The Blues had already had a heavy hand for Cucurella (65 million euros). There has also been a lot of talk about Antony who joined Manchester United for 100 million euros. These examples, among others, confirm that English clubs do not experience the same economic reality as others in Europe, and that they reign on the transfer market.
